Collection Agency/Social Security Disability

Can a collection agency attach my Social Security Disability income, if thats all I have...No assets at all, except my 1998 vehicle. I was out of work 1 1/2 yrs and became disabled

No. Social security income is not garnishable under Florida law. Your vehicle may be able to be attached depending on the equity in the car.

Social security..no. Car..you have $1000.00 exemption in it.
